网站数据库文件名是连接网站前端用户界面与后端数据存储的关键标识符,它并非一个固定的、统一的名称,而是根据网站所采用的技术栈、内容管理系统(CMS)或开发者的个人习惯而动态定义的,理解其命名规则和查找方法,对于网站的日常维护、数据备份、迁移以及故障排查至关重要。
主流CMS系统的数据库文件名
对于使用成熟CMS构建的网站,数据库名称通常在核心配置文件中明确指定,这使得定位和管理变得相对标准化。
WordPress: 全球最流行的博客和网站建设平台WordPress,其数据库名称被定义在网站根目录下的 wp-config.php
文件中,打开此文件,您会找到类似以下的代码行:define('DB_NAME', 'my_wp_database');
这里的 'my_wp_database'
就是当前网站所使用的数据库名称,这个名称在WordPress安装过程中由用户设定,通常是具有描述性的,如 wp_myblog
或 mycompany_wp
。
Joomla与Drupal: 与WordPress类似,其他主流CMS如Joomla和Drupal也将数据库连接信息存储在配置文件中,Joomla的配置文件是 configuration.php
,而Drupal则通常位于 sites/default/settings.php
文件内,在这些文件中,您可以搜索 $db
、database
或 DB_NAME
等关键词,以找到确切的数据库名称。
自定义开发网站的数据库命名
对于由开发团队从零开始构建的网站,数据库名称拥有完全的自由度,开发者会根据项目需求、团队规范或个人偏好进行命名,这类名称可能包含项目代号、客户名称、功能描述等元素,project_alpha_v2
、client_crm_db
或 app_production_2025
。
在这种情况下,虽然没有固定的文件可以查看,但优秀的开发者通常会遵循一套内部规范,数据库本身的类型(如MySQL, PostgreSQL, SQLite)也影响其实际形态,SQLite数据库就是一个单一的、具有特定名称的文件(如 database.sqlite
),而MySQL则是一个在服务器上创建的逻辑名称。
如何快速查找数据库文件名
无论您的网站基于何种技术,以下几种方法都能帮助您快速定位数据库名称:
- 检查配置文件: 这是最直接、最推荐的方法,找到您网站系统的核心配置文件(如上文所述的
wp-config.php
),用文本编辑器打开即可看到。 - 使用主机控制面板: 大多数虚拟主机都提供cPanel、Plesk等控制面板,登录后,找到“数据库”或“phpMyAdmin”等工具,在phpMyAdmin的左侧列表中,通常会显示您账户下所有数据库名称,结合网站功能可以判断出具体是哪一个。
- 咨询开发者或主机商: 如果您不具备技术操作权限,最稳妥的方式是联系当初为您建站的开发者或您的主机提供商客服,他们可以从后台为您查询。
为了更清晰地展示不同类型网站的查找方式,可以参考下表:
网站类型 | 核心配置文件 | 主要查找方法 |
---|---|---|
WordPress | wp-config.php | 直接查看配置文件或通过cPanel/phpMyAdmin |
Joomla | configuration.php | 直接查看配置文件或通过cPanel/phpMyAdmin |
自定义网站 | 不固定 | 查看项目文档、联系开发者或通过主机控制面板 |
命名规范与安全考量
一个良好的数据库名称应当具备描述性、简洁性和安全性。
- 规范性: 推荐使用小写字母、数字和下划线(_)的组合,避免使用空格或特殊字符,使用
my_shop_db
而不是My Shop DB
,这有助于提高跨平台兼容性并避免潜在的错误。 - 安全性: 数据库名称是潜在攻击者可能尝试猜测的目标之一,避免使用过于简单或默认的名称,如
test
、wordpress
、db1
等,一个好的安全实践是在数据库名称前添加一个随机且不易猜测的前缀,a3k8m_myshop_db
,这可以增加暴力破解的难度,为数据库提供一层额外的保护。
相关问答FAQs
问题1:我可以随意更改我的数据库文件名吗?
解答: 不可以,数据库名称是网站连接数据库的核心凭证之一,它与配置文件中的设置是严格绑定的,如果您仅在服务器端更改了数据库名称,而未同步更新网站配置文件(如 wp-config.php
),网站将立即无法连接到数据库,导致前台页面崩溃并显示“建立数据库连接时出错”等提示,正确的更改步骤是:1. 在主机控制面板或通过数据库管理工具重命名数据库;2. 立即登录到您的网站服务器,找到并编辑相应的配置文件,将旧的 DB_NAME
值修改为新的数据库名称,然后保存文件。
问题2:如果我完全忘记了数据库名称和密码,还能找回网站吗?
解答: 有很大的机会可以找回,请保持冷静,并按照以下步骤尝试:1. 首选方案:检查配置文件。 这是恢复信息最可靠的来源,2. 次选方案:登录主机控制面板。 在cPanel等面板中,您不仅可以查看数据库名称,通常还可以重置数据库用户密码,重置后,记得将新密码同步更新到网站的配置文件中,3. 最终方案:联系主机提供商。 如果您无法通过上述方法解决,请联系您的主机客服,他们拥有最高权限,可以帮助您核实身份后,从服务器层面直接获取或重置您的数据库凭证信息。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复